Case Summary: Continental Advertising Pvt. Ltd. v. Pritpal Singh (SLP(C) 5340/2007) The Supreme Court dismissed Continental Advertising's special leave petition challenging the Delhi High Court's orders dated 7 February 2007 and 2 March 2007, finding no merit in the appeal. However, recognizing the commercial nature of the premises involved, the Court granted the petitioner six months from 30 March 2007 to vacate the suit premises, conditional on filing a standard undertaking within two weeks.
